Overclocking refers to the exercise of growing the clock pace of a computer's CPU further than its factory-set limitations. This process will allow the processor to perform a lot more calculations for each 2nd, correctly boosting its effectiveness. The clock pace, calculated in gigahertz (GHz), dictates the quantity of cycles a CPU can execute inside a provided time frame.
By changing the multiplier or foundation clock frequency in the system's BIOS or specialised software package, people can unlock supplemental general performance potential. Nonetheless, it is crucial to understand that not all CPUs are designed for overclocking; only those with an unlocked multiplier, which include Intel's "K" sequence or AMD's Ryzen processors, are usually appropriate for this enhancement. The mechanics of overclocking include increasing voltage and frequency configurations, which may result in increased efficiency ranges.
When a CPU operates at an increased frequency, it might procedure extra facts simultaneously, resulting in a lot quicker software overall performance and enhanced gaming encounters. However, this increase in velocity generates further warmth, necessitating powerful cooling solutions to forestall thermal throttling or damage to the CPU. Knowledge the architecture of one's precise processor and its thermal limits is critical for successful overclocking, since it permits consumers to locate the optimum harmony concerning functionality gains and procedure stability.

The Dangers and Benefits of Overclocking Your CPU
While overclocking can generate major functionality enhancements, It's not necessarily devoid of its threats. Considered one of the first fears will be the likely for overheating. As the CPU operates at greater speeds, it generates extra warmth, which can lead to thermal throttling or perhaps long-lasting injury Otherwise managed effectively.
On top of that, rising the voltage to achieve higher clock speeds can shorten the lifespan on the CPU and other parts due to improved electrical worry. Customers have to remember that overclocking voids warranties For several processors, which means that any hurt incurred during the process might not be protected by the manufacturer. Within the flip side, the rewards of productive overclocking is often sizeable.
Avid gamers and content creators frequently find out overclocking to reinforce their devices' general performance devoid of purchasing new components. For illustration, a modest overclock can lead to smoother body rates in demanding games or faster rendering times in online video enhancing program. What's more, overclocking can offer a value-successful way to extend the lifetime of more mature components by maximizing its capabilities.
When finished the right way, consumers can experience a noticeable Increase in general performance that enhances their General computing expertise.
Crucial Resources and Software program for Profitable Overclocking
To embark on an overclocking journey, users have to have a set of essential applications and application that facilitate checking and changes. Just about the most essential resources is usually a reputable temperature monitoring software, like HWMonitor or Main Temp. These applications present true-time knowledge on CPU temperatures, permitting people to ensure that their processors remain in Safe and sound functioning boundaries through overclocking sessions.
On top of that, stress-testing application like Prime95 or AIDA64 is vital for assessing process stability soon after making changes. These courses force the CPU to its restrictions, encouraging buyers establish any probable issues ahead of they manifest all through typical use. Yet another critical element of prosperous overclocking is gaining access to BIOS options or user-welcoming software package provided by motherboard brands.
Several modern-day motherboards occur Geared up with built-in utilities that enable customers to adjust clock speeds and voltages directly from the working technique. Such as, ASUS's AI Suite or MSI's Afterburner offers intuitive interfaces for tweaking settings with no need to reboot into BIOS regularly.

Overclocking Dos and Don'ts: Finest Practices for the Secure and Harmless Method
To ensure a successful overclocking working experience, adhering to very best methods is important. Considered one of the first dos is always to just take incremental methods when changing clock speeds and voltages. Earning compact changes permits customers to monitor system steadiness and temperatures efficiently prior to committing to extra major adjustments.
Additionally, generally be certain that adequate cooling remedies are set up—irrespective of whether by way of air cooling or liquid cooling systems—to control increased heat output efficiently. Conversely, there are many important don'ts that users need to avoid throughout the overclocking method. Just one main pitfall is neglecting to observe temperatures routinely; failing to take action can result in overheating and opportunity components injury.
Yet another frequent blunder is rushing into intense overclocks with no appropriate testing; security really should generally be prioritized about Uncooked functionality gains. And finally, consumers ought to chorus from working with extreme voltage will increase past what on earth is needed for attaining stable performance, as This could certainly noticeably lessen component lifespan and trustworthiness.
